Description:
Google2FA is a PHP implementation of the Google Two-Factor Authentication
Module, supporting the HMAC-Based One-time Password (HOTP) algorithm
specified in RFC 4226 and the Time-based One-time Password (TOTP) algorithm
specified in RFC 6238.
